KATHMANDU:  The Goldhunga Sports Society has raised Rs 5 million to construct a stadium at Goldhunga in Kathmandu by organizing Srimad Bhagwat Saptaha Gyan Mahayagya.

In the memory of late congress leader Sudarshan Acharya, ‘Sudarshan Goldhunga Memorial Stadium’ is to be constructed by the Goldhunga Sports Society.

Acharya was the founding chair of the society. The Society owns 75 ropanis of land in Goldhunga where the stadium will be used, according to  Devendra Aryal, secretary of the Society.
